The Company offers an array of comprehensive services that can take product from origin pickup and ocean freight to customs clearance, drayage and delivery with additional options to respond to regulatory changes and extend shelf life:
- Bonded warehousing capacity at more than 60 facilities worldwide – providing expanded access for customers who rely on secure, compliant storage ahead of customs clearance
- Bonded transportation services that enable in-bond transfers that allow customers to move cargo between bonded facilities without triggering duty payments
-
USDA Inspection (I-House) capabilities on site at 42 facilities in the
U.S. , which specialize in USDA-approved in-house inspection of imported meat, poultry, and select seafoods (including catfish) - Blast freezing capacity at more than 100 facilities around the globe – enabling protein and seafood exporters to leverage these services that capture freshness and quality prior to leaving port
- Port-centric warehousing is baked into Lineage’s warehousing network by design with the Company operating more than 220 port-centric locations around the world
-
Freight forwarding capabilities that span the US,
UK ,Netherlands ,Poland andSouth Africa and trusted, established partners in other global markets – allowing Lineage to coordinate customers’ product journey from end to end on a global scale -
Customs brokerage services to navigate the regulatory headaches for customers and clear all commodities (not just food) at ports across the US,
UK and EU
Supporting these offerings is Lineage’s dedicated Import and Export Excellence Team, comprised of over 20 specialists focused exclusively on compliance, documentation and process optimization for products moving in and out of the

About Lineage
Lineage, Inc. (NASDAQ: LINE) is the world’s largest global temperature-controlled warehouse REIT with a network of over 485 strategically located facilities totaling approximately 86 million square feet and approximately 3.1 billion cubic feet of capacity across countries in
